Step into a rewarding contract position delivering speech-language pathology services to students in grades 6-8 or 10-12 on the southwest side of the Houston area. This full-time opportunity begins August 11, 2026, and runs through May 26, 2027, offering a consistent weekly schedule of 37.5 hours. With a manageable caseload of 5060 students, youll provide essential therapy, participate in ARDs and testing, and help students thrive academically and socially. If you prefer, theres also an option to focus on supervision responsibilities.
Primary skills and experience sought include:
- Active Texas FL speech-language pathology license (please provide an image of your license)
- Previous experience in a school-based SLP setting
- Comfort with middle/secondary age groups (grades 68 or 1012)
- Familiarity with ARDs, therapy delivery, and evaluation/testing processes
- Commitment to timely completion of district-required fingerprinting
- Flexibility to work across the Houston area, with school assignments mindful of your ZIP code
- Willingness to complete a brief prescreen interview as part of the onboarding process
Responsibilities youll enjoy:
- Delivering direct speech-language therapy to students
- Conducting assessments and participating in ARDs to support student IEP goals
- Documenting services accurately and maintaining compliance with district guidelines
- Collaborating with campus staff to ensure student progress
- Option to provide supervision only, if desired
Take advantage of a supportive contract environment where your expertise makes a daily impact. Youll be assigned to either middle or high school levels based on your preferences and experience.
